Hurdles, unwelcome
Like it or not, transport disruption is least desired. No tranport. No raw materials @ plant. No trucks. No dispatch of finished products. Nightmare.
Cargo safety, Big Challenge
Accidents on highways due to lack of rest room and fatigue affects your career by affecting operations at your plant.
Highway sign awareness
Automotive Skill Development Council dipstick survey claims poor knowledge of highway signs among truck drivers
Highway sign awareness
So… educate truck drivers on highway signages. Go to factory gates (inbound/outbound). Conduct classes for them on roadside.
Highway sign awareness
An aware driver means safe delivery of your raw materials and finished products. All in your OWN interest…
Driver fatigue, Killer
Lack of sleep or apnea reduces concentration and decision-making abilities. Yes, fatigue is the biggest cause for accidents on highways – challenging your delivery schedules of raw materials/finished items
Personal hygiene, pathetic
This truck driver is carrying a bottle of water … not for drinking but …. To complete his bowel cleaning exercise behind bushes under open sky on highways. Why? No highway amenities.
Hello…
IN YOUR OWN INTEREST
Restroom @ Factory Gates
Build portacabins with toilet facilities @ factory gates (inbound/outbound) and @ warehouses

IMPROVING Truck Drivers’ Working & Living Conditions
What I DO: DHABA DIALOGUE
Halt @ dhabas on highways to engage them to talk about their challenges on road and at home.
FACTORY GATE MEET
Visit factory gates for interaction with inbound/outbound truck drivers to check facilities offered to them by OEMs/3PLs
Family connect via Village Visits
Arrange village visits for 3PLs, OEMs, Transporters for interaction with truck drivers’ families living in remote parts of India
‘Donate sleep’ initiative
Distribute soft pillows to help drivers sleep well.
